When you join our team as a Site Director you will:

  • Lead and supervise a group of teachers to create unique and engaging classroom experiences leverage and develop best in class educators to be passionate and committed professionals
  • Ensure your site is operating effectively; maintain licensing safety and educational standards
  • Partner with parents with a shared desire to provide the best care and education for their children
  • Cultivate positive relationships with families teachers school and district leaders state licensing authorities community contacts and corporate partners
  • Lead recruitment and enrollment efforts of new families and children in our sites

Required Skills and Experience:

  • At least one year of teaching experience with the ability to develop engage and inspire a team
  • A love for children and a strong desire to make a difference every day
  • Ability to build relationships with families and staff and create a dynamic environment where play and discovery go hand-in-hand
  • Outstanding customer service skills strong organizational skills multi-task and manage multiple situations effectively
  • Meet state specific guidelines for the role
  • Be physically able to use a computer with basic proficiency lift a minimum of 40 pounds and work indoors or outdoors. Be able to assume postures in low levels to allow physical and visual contact with children see and hear well enough to keep children safe and engage in physical activity
  • Read write understand and speak English to communicate with children and their parents in English
